Understanding Automatic Roulette Tables

Automatic roulette tables, also known as electronic or digital roulette tables, use computer-generated algorithms to determine the outcome of each spin. These tables consist of a digital wheel and a virtual layout, replacing the traditional human dealer and physical wheel. The entire game process is automated, from placing bets to spinning the wheel.

One of the key aspects of automatic roulette tables is the Random Number Generator (RNG). This software ensures that the results of each spin are completely random and unbiased. The RNG uses complex algorithms to generate a sequence of numbers, mimicking the randomness of a physical roulette wheel. This technology is regularly tested and certified by independent auditing companies to ensure fair play.

It is important to note that the outcome of each spin on an automatic roulette table is determined solely by the RNG. The software is not influenced by any external factors, such as how players place their bets or any previous results. This means that the game remains fair and untainted by human interference.

Regulation and Licensing of Automatic Roulette Tables

To ensure the integrity of automatic roulette tables, reputable online casinos and land-based gambling establishments follow strict regulations and obtain licenses from regulatory bodies. These organizations, such as the United Kingdom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ority, oversee and enforce the fair operation of gambling activities.

Before granting a license, the regulatory bodies conduct thorough inspections of the software used in automatic roulette tables. They scrutinize the RNG to ensure that it meets the necessary standards for randomness and fairness. By obtaining a license, casinos are held accountable for providing a fair gambling environment and are subject to regular audits to maintain their license.

It is crucial for players to choose licensed and regulated casinos when playing on automatic roulette tables. This provides an extra layer of assurance that the game is not rigged and that they are on a level playing field with other players.

1. How do automatic roulette tables work?

Automatic roulette tables use an electronic interface to simulate the spinning of the wheel and the ball’s movement. The outcome of each spin is determined by a random number generator (RNG) that ensures fairness.

The RNG generates a random number corresponding to a specific position on the wheel, which is translated into the winning number. This means that the outcome of each spin is completely random and not influenced by external factors.
